A Chandpur court yesterday sent three local BNP leaders to jail after rejecting their bail prayers in a case filed for arson attack on a truck that left four people killed in sadar upazila on March 18 during the hartal called by BNP-led alliance. They are Sheikh Farid Ahmed Manik, district unit president of BNP and also a member of BNP central committee, Akter Hossain Majhi, general secretary of town unit BNP and Afzal Hossain Bepari, general secretary of district unit Juba Dal. Senior Judicial Magistrate Mostain Billah rejected the bail prayers of the accused and sent them to jail.
